Air-India Express To Launch This Summer

Air India recently announced the launch of its low budget carrier, Air-India Express to commence operations by summer 2005. Reveals V Thulasidas, CMD, Air-India, " The airline will fly out of Trivandrum, Kochi, Calicut, Chennai, Mumbai, Delhi, Kolkata and Guwahati to all points that Air-India operates to in the Gulf except Saudi Arabia and South-East Asia i.e. Bangkok, Kuala Lumpur, Singapore. The South-East Asia destinations will be connected in a phased manner." Though still in the development process, the airline is optimistic of its take off. According to Thulasidas, there will definitely be different fare structures, which are lower than the current available fares. He claimed that with the growing traffic between India and the Gulf, the airline will serve the purpose, as it will be an all-economy airline wherein the service will be scaled down but the aircraft will all be new. The booking structure will include the web and travel agents."
